The five incidents where sports personalities' rights were violated are about Colin Kaepernick, Caster Semenya, Carlos Delgado, Mahmoud Abdul-Rauf, Tommie Smith, and John Carlos.

1. Colin Kaepernick: In 2016, NFL player Colin Kaepernick protested against police brutality by kneeling during the national anthem. As a result, he faced significant backlash, with many accusing him of being unpatriotic and disrespectful. His right to freedom of expression and peaceful protest was violated.

2. Caster Semenya: In 2019, the International Association of Athletics Federations (IAAF) imposed new regulations that require female athletes with high testosterone levels to take medication to reduce their levels. South African athlete Caster Semenya, who has naturally high levels of testosterone, challenged the regulations, arguing that they were discriminatory and violated her right to bodily integrity and autonomy.

3. Carlos Delgado: In 2004, baseball player Carlos Delgado chose not to stand during the singing of "God Bless America" at games to protest against the war in Iraq. He was criticized by some fans and the media for his stance, with some calling for him to be suspended. His right to freedom of expression and peaceful protest was violated.

4. Mahmoud Abdul-Rauf: In 1996, NBA player Mahmoud Abdul-Rauf refused to stand for the national anthem, citing his Islamic beliefs and opposition to American policies. He was suspended by the NBA for one game and eventually reached a compromise that allowed him to pray during the anthem instead. His right to freedom of religion and belief was violated.

5. Tommie Smith and John Carlos: In 1968, American track and field athletes Tommie Smith and John Carlos raised their fists in a black power salute during the medal ceremony at the Olympics. They were subsequently expelled from the games and faced significant backlash upon their return home. Their right to freedom of expression and peaceful protest was violated.

The missing component in this study is a "control group."

A control group is a group of individuals who do not receive the experimental treatment or product being tested. In this case, the control group would consist of students who do not consume the energy drink. The purpose of a control group is to provide a baseline for comparison.

By having a control group, researchers can determine whether any observed improvements in memory can be attributed to the energy drink or if they may be due to other factors, such as a placebo effect or natural variations. In the given scenario, the energy drink company claims that 8 out of 10 people who tried their product reported improved memory.

However, without a control group, it is impossible to know if the reported improvements are genuinely due to the energy drink or if they would have occurred even without consuming it. To properly evaluate the effects of the energy drink on memory, a controlled study design is needed.

This would involve randomly assigning participants into two groups: an experimental group that receives the energy drink and a control group that does not. Both groups would be assessed for memory levels using reliable and valid measurement methods.

The character trait Odysseus displays when he listens to the Sirens' song is self-sacrifice. The Option C.

How does Odysseus demonstrate self-sacrifice?

Odysseus displays self-sacrifice by willingly putting himself in danger to protect his crew. In Greek mythology, the Sirens were mythical creatures whose enchanting songs lured sailors to their doom.

Odysseus being aware of the danger wanted to hear the Sirens' song but knew that it would be irresistible to his men. To ensure their safety, he ordered his crew to tie him to the mast of the ship and instructed them to ignore his commands to be released no matter how much he begged.

Who is Washington, Booker T?

Booker T. Washington (1856-1915) was born into slavery and grew to prominence as a notable African American intellectual of the nineteenth century, establishing Tuskegee Normal and Industrial Institute (now Tuskegee University) in 1881 and the National Negro Business League about two decades later.

Washington was hailed as a national hero in September 1895. When invited to speak at the Cotton States and International Exposition in Atlanta in 1895, Washington openly endorsed disfranchisement and social discrimination as long as whites allowed black economic advancement, educational opportunity, and legal justice.

The statement is True. Here are four different occupations that Old Testament writers held:

Prophets: Many of the Old Testament books were written by prophets, believed to have received divine inspiration and messages from God. Examples of prophet writers include Isaiah, Jeremiah, and Ezekiel.

Priests: Some Old Testament books, particularly those in the Pentateuch (the first five books of the Bible), were written by priests. Priests were responsible for leading religious rituals and ceremonies and had extensive knowledge of religious law. Moses, traditionally believed to have written the first five books of the Bible, was a priest.

Kings: Several Old Testament books were written by kings or people associated with royalty. For example, King David wrote many of the Psalms, and King Solomon is traditionally believed to have written the books of Proverbs, Ecclesiastes, and the Song of Solomon.

Scribes: Scribes were trained in writing and record-keeping and were responsible for copying and preserving important documents. Some Old Testament writers were likely scribes, such as the anonymous author(s) of the book of Ruth, which is written in a literary style similar to that of other ancient Near Eastern documents.

1The mere-exposure effect—the tendency to like someone better simply because of frequent exposure to him or her—has been observed in studies. 2In one study, college students were shown pictures of faces. 3Some of the faces were shown as many as twenty-five times; others, only once or twice. 4Afterward, subjects indicated how much they liked each face and how much they thought they would like the person pictured. 5The more often the subjects had seen a face, the more they said they liked it and thought they would like the person. 6The same result has been found for repeated exposure to actual people. 7In a recent study, researchers enlisted the aid of four college women who served as confederates in an experiment. 8A pretest showed that all women were rated as equally attractive. 9In the study, each woman attended a large lecture class in social psychology, posing as a student in the course. 10Each woman attended a different number of class sessions—once, five times, ten times, or fifteen times during the term. 11At the end of the term, students in the class were asked to rate each woman, based on a casual photo shown as a slide. 12The more often students had seen the woman, the more they thought they would like her.

In Act I, Scene 2, Ariel uses his magical powers to put Gonzalo, Alonso, and other members of the ship's crew to sleep. This allows Prospero and Miranda to approach the ship undetected and discuss their plan to seek revenge against those who wronged them.

Later in the play, Prospero also puts Caliban and his companions to sleep in order to prevent them from interfering with his plans.

Thus, the characters are put to sleep to serve as a plot device that allows the main characters to execute their plans without facing any resistance or opposition.
